Summary: Not a luxury apartment by any stretch of imagination I liked: The staff spoke in a welcoming and polite way. At first glance, the apartment appears clean and well-maintained, but once you open the washer/dishwasher/fridge. The kitchen appears to be well-equipped, and the bathrooms and bedrooms seem well-appointed. There were complimentary tooth brushes, tooth pastes, and shower caps, but no bottled water! I did not like: We stayed in apartment 509, a two-bedroom on the fifth floor. The check-in process is convoluted with guests' headshots taken from all angles as if you were a criminal. For Hyatus, your credit card is not enough--this tells me the place is not used to distinguished guests. The five-minute check-in video is not just unhelpful; it is misleading and a waste of time. There is no designated parking space, despite what is shown (that building has no designated spots--anyone can park anywhere), and luggage carts are nearly impossible to find because they are not returned to the lobby. Second, the cleanliness and housekeeping are really poor: visible hair, dirty appliances (washer, dishwasher, refrigerator all had stains or gunk), unclean shower curtains, and signs of rushed or careless cleaning are what we dealt with after an exhausting trip (I took many pictures) before cleaning and disinfecting everything. Also, the trash bins had no liners (we had to find and put them in), no toilet paper in place, and overall, it was not ready for check-in. Third and most important, its misleading “luxury” claim: Uncomfortable dining setup, impractical furniture, no workspace (no desk anywhere), allergen-filled tight couches, and poor soundproofing with terrible noise of traffic, construction, sirens, and trains making it hard to sleep or function. Uncomfortable stay for working guests: Internet stopped working after the first day, and there are no essential stores or restaurants within walking distance, making the stay inconvenient. There were no water bottles in our room either.
